I did some research on prior threads and see some conflicting information.

What is Disney's policy about exchanging table service for counter service or counter service for snacks?

Ms. Mode
03-16-2010, 02:23 PM
They will not let you use a TS for a CS meal, or a CS meal for a snack.

You can use two TS for a signature meal, but they let you know it's going to take two in advance. :mickey:

During the September 2008 free dining promotion when many, many places where fully booked, Disney allowed you to exchange a TS credit for a CS meal and you got a coupon for 2 snacks--but I believe this was a one time offer, it wasn't repeated in September 2009.

I think you can generally exchange down, I have heard many reports of folks using remaining CS credits to get extra snacks to take home. I've never heard getting 2 CS for one TS, that seems like too good a deal for Disney to allow it.

But there may be some limitations or exceptions, especially with 3rd party/outside food service operators. This could explain the post about the Earl of Sandwich allowing several snacks. But an outside operator many not be able to access a TS credit for CS--I know they use a credit card reader to access the Disney system, but may not have as much information as the folks with a Disney based checkout terminal--anyone have specific knowledge or experience?
